A1 is seeking an Entrepreneur in Residence to work with founders on high-priority initiatives across hiring, market expansion, partnerships, and operations.

You will turn ideas into execution, take ownership from day one, and move quickly in a hands-on environment.

The role emphasizes collaboration with senior leaders and representing the company at events and external engagements.

How to prepare for a job interview at jobr.pro

Show Your Entrepreneurial Spirit

In startups, they love seeing passion and initiative. Be ready to share any personal projects or ideas you've worked on. This shows you’re not just about the 9-to-5, but you’re invested in creating value, which is key in this fast-paced environment.

Brush Up on Your Problem-Solving Skills

Expect to be thrown some curveballs during the interview—startups often face unexpected challenges. Having a couple of examples up your sleeve where you’ve creatively solved problems will really impress them. It's all about how you think on your feet!

Know Your Stuff About the Industry

Since you're applying for a full-time role, they’ll want to see you've done your homework. Make sure you understand where the startup stands in its industry, including competitors and market trends. It’s a great way to show you're genuinely interested and can contribute from day one.

Show Flexibility and Adaptability

Startups can pivot quickly, so highlight your adaptability. Share examples of when you've successfully navigated change or taken on roles outside your comfort zone. This shows you’re ready for whatever comes your way, which is crucial in a startup atmosphere!
